Author: max.andersen(a)jboss.com
Date: 2012-04-26 07:14:17 -0400 (Thu, 26 Apr 2012)
New Revision: 40517
Modified:
trunk/maven/plugins/org.jboss.tools.maven.gwt/src/org/jboss/tools/maven/gwt/GWTProjectConfigurator.java
Log:
JBIDE-11675 avoid NPE when project does not have GWT config
Modified:
trunk/maven/plugins/org.jboss.tools.maven.gwt/src/org/jboss/tools/maven/gwt/GWTProjectConfigurator.java
===================================================================
---
trunk/maven/plugins/org.jboss.tools.maven.gwt/src/org/jboss/tools/maven/gwt/GWTProjectConfigurator.java 2012-04-26
10:43:50 UTC (rev 40516)
+++
trunk/maven/plugins/org.jboss.tools.maven.gwt/src/org/jboss/tools/maven/gwt/GWTProjectConfigurator.java 2012-04-26
11:14:17 UTC (rev 40517)
@@ -87,6 +87,11 @@
boolean configureGWT = store.getBoolean(Activator.CONFIGURE_GWT);
if(configureGWT){
Plugin newConfig =
event.getMavenProject().getMavenProject().getPlugin(GWT_WAR_MAVEN_PLUGIN_KEY);
+ if(newConfig==null) {
+ // no config found so just stop.
+ return;
+ }
+
IJavaProject javaProject = JavaCore.create(event.getMavenProject().getProject());
List<String> modNames = findModules(newConfig, javaProject);
Show replies by date